When Women Say Yes: Consent in Sex and Love – Simcha Fisher

Society says that consent is the most important part of sex - but is it? SImcha Fisher explores how we should think about consent, whether Mary the mother of God gave consent to her pregnancy, and what the Catholic perspective on these issues means for women.

Up Next

No items found.
By clicking “Accept”, you agree to the storing of cookies on your device to enhance site navigation, analyze site usage, and assist in our marketing efforts. View our Privacy Policy for more information.